This episode was really raw. I really felt for Amethyst and Pearl, and the "Cry For Help" title just gets sadder in retrospect.
It was really impressive on a meta level, too; both in the use of the Crying Breakfast Friends juxtaposed in between scenes and the last line of the episode. We, like Steven, often look to works of media with positive messages, or tackle down-to-earth issues we struggle with confronting in real life (Steven Universe is one of these works of media, for many!). We often expect episodes like these to end with advice or clarity and closure as many prior episodes have; but like life, sometimes things just don't go that way.
"It sure would be nice if things worked out the way they did in cartoons."
Amethyst's line serves as both to deliver the episode's message "Sometimes, there aren't any easy ways out" as well as give some fourth-wall-breaking-reassurance for people who are attached to and identify with this show that their favorite characters sometimes don't know what to do, either. It's something the show already does continuously (that is, reassure us that our favorite characters can make the same kind of mistakes and screw-ups we can), but here it addresses it upfront.
